Manchester United are pulling back from talks for Borussia Dortmund defender Mats Hummels.
The People says Louis van Gaal is facing disappointment in his battle to land Hummels with Borussia Dortmund refusing to do business.
Hummels has always been the Manchester United manager's top defensive target.
A source close to Dortmund said: "We've spoken with the player and it is true that some clubs are interested, but we have rejected the chance to negotiate.
"Mats is happy in Dortmund and will be with us next term."
United rate Hummels at around £16million - £7m shy of the release clause in his deal.
